Ukraine and Azerbaijan discussed cooperation in the energy sector
![]() 2248 Saturday, 12 July, 2025, 21:52 The 13th session of the Ukrainian-Azerbaijani intergovernmental commission on economic cooperation was held in Baku. This was reported by the Minister of Energy of Ukraine German Galushenko. “I am grateful to Azerbaijan for its solidarity and support, in particular, for the humanitarian aid that helps overcome energy challenges. We discussed the main areas of bilateral cooperation, in particular in the energy sector. Much attention was paid to the development of strategic projects aimed at increasing energy security. The session of the intergovernmental commission held today in Baku is an important step towards further expanding our economic ties. We appreciate the constructive dialogue and mutual determination to achieve concrete results,” Galushenko wrote on his Facebook page. |
